About Takeshi Ishihara
Takeshi Ishihara is a scholar working on Environmental Engineering, Computational Mechanics and Earth-Surface Processes, having authored 194 papers that have together received 4.4k indexed citations. Recurring topics across this work include Wind and Air Flow Studies (89 papers), Fluid Dynamics and Vibration Analysis (44 papers) and Wind Energy Research and Development (35 papers). The work is most often cited by research in Environmental Engineering (1.8k citations), Computational Mechanics (1.5k citations) and Aerospace Engineering (1.6k citations). Takeshi Ishihara has collaborated with scholars based in Japan, China and United States. Frequent co-authors include Guowei Qian, Shigekazu Nagata, Kenji Takahashi, Kensaku Mori, Ryuichi Shigemoto, Zhenqing Liu, Kenji Shimada, Kazuki HIBI, Tian Li and Atsushi YAMAGUCHI. Their work appears in journals such as Neuron, The EMBO Journal and Biochemistry.
